Q: Is 40,031,507 a Prime Number?
A: No, 40,031,507 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 40031507 can be evenly divided by 1 2,089 19,163 and 40,031,507, with no remainder.
Since 40,031,507 cannot be divided by just 1 and 40,031,507, it is not a prime number.
